Accounting Faculty 

Faculty members of FAU’s School of Accounting have high academic qualifications and maintain close links with the accounting profession. All tenure-track accounting faculty are Ph.D.s and members of the FAU Graduate Faculty. Many are CPAs, CMAs, and hold other professional accreditations. Members of the faculty have served in positions of leadership in the American Accounting Association and have served as editor or on the editorial boards of the leading academic journals in accounting. Faculty members have also been involved with the Public Company Auditing Oversight Board, American Institute of Certified Public Accounting, and Florida Society of Certified Public Accountings.

FAU accounting faculty members are successful researchers, across a variety of interests in accounting scholarship. The diversity of their research interests and expertise is evident by reviewing a list of their publications in academic and professional accounting journals.
